+ On modern version control systems that have built-in support for
+renaming, the renamed file retains the full change history of the
+original file. On CVS and older version control systems, the
+@code{vc-rename-file} command actually works by creating a copy of the
+old file under the new name, registering it, and deleting the old
+file. In this case, the change history is not preserved.

+ In file-based version control systems, when you rename a registered
+file you need to rename its master along with it; the command
+@code{vc-rename-file} will do this automatically
+@iftex
+(@pxref{VC Delete/Rename,,,emacs, the Emacs Manual}).
+@end iftex
+@ifnottex
+(@pxref{VC Delete/Rename}).
+@end ifnottex
+If you are using SCCS, you must also update the records of the tag, to
+mention the file by its new name (@code{vc-rename-file} does this,
+too). An old tag that refers to a master file that no longer exists
+under the recorded name is invalid; VC can no longer retrieve it. It
+would be beyond the scope of this manual to explain enough about RCS
+and SCCS to explain how to update the tags by hand. Using
+@code{vc-rename-file} makes the tag remain valid for retrieval, but it
+does not solve all problems. For example, some of the files in your
+program probably refer to others by name. At the very least, the
+makefile probably mentions the file that you renamed. If you retrieve
+an old tag, the renamed file is retrieved under its new name, which is
+not the name that the makefile expects. So the program won't really
+work as retrieved.
